Hamilton, Ontario
Caistorville, Ontario
Kitchener, Ontario
Paris, Ontario
Waterloo, Ontario
Waterloo, Ontario
Waterford, Ontario
Niagara Falls, Ontario
Waterloo, Ontario
Waterloo, Ontario
Waterloo, Ontario
Waterloo, Ontario
Toronto, Ontario
Mount Hope, Ontario
Toronto, Ontario
Waterloo, Ontario
Richmond Hill, Ontario
Ajax, Ontario
Aurora, Ontario
Kitchener, Ontario
Kitchener, Ontario
Kitchener, Ontario
Kitchener, Ontario
Toronto, Ontario
Waterloo, Ontario
Brantford, Ontario
Oakville, Ontario
Brantford, Ontario
Toronto, Ontario
St. Catharines, Ontario
Richmond Hill, Ontario
Markham, Ontario
Kitchener, Ontario
Kitchener, Ontario
Kitchener, Ontario
Kitchener, Ontario
Kitchener, Ontario
Kitchener, Ontario
Kitchener, Ontario